What Role Does Audience Reception Play In Character Development For Fan Fiction Compared To Original Narratives?
Gathering question image...
Introduction
Audience reception is a crucial element in both fan fiction and original narratives, significantly impacting character development. Understanding these dynamics can greatly enhance the writing and reading experience for creators and readers alike.
The Impact of Audience Feedback on Fan Fiction
In the realm of fan fiction, authors often develop stories using established characters and settings, making audience reception a vital force in shaping character depth and plot trajectories. Reader feedback can lead to changes in character representations and interpersonal dynamics, fostering more complex interpretations.
- Reader feedback helps authors refine character traits, making them resonate more authentically with audience expectations.
- Regular interaction with the audience allows writers to identify trending themes and beloved characters, leading to narrative adjustments that emphasize these popular elements.
Comparison with Original Narratives
Conversely, original narratives are primarily shaped by the author's vision, although they are sometimes influenced by market dynamics or audience responses. Authors may take into account critiques from beta readers or focus groups, particularly in the editing phase. Nonetheless, the intricacy of character development in original works is more often driven by the author’s creative intention rather than direct audience influence.
- Original characters are usually developed through in-depth exploration of themes significant to the author, nurturing a unique narrative voice.
- The lack of immediate audience pressure provides the opportunity for more innovative or unconventional character paths, which may not always align with mainstream audience expectations.
Balancing Audience Reception with Artistic Integrity
Both fan fiction and original narratives involve balancing audience reception with creative freedom. Understanding this balance can enhance storytelling, regardless of genre.
- Writers need to cultivate resilience to feedback while remaining dedicated to their artistic vision.
- Successful adaptations of characters in fan fiction can inspire original works that reflect audience desires, showcasing the interplay between both forms of storytelling.
Conclusion
In summary, audience reception significantly influences character development in fan fiction, contrasting with the often singular vision present in original narratives. Writers can enhance their work by understanding these dynamics, merging audience insights with their own creative processes.
